Clippers To Raise Funds At Tonight’s Jazz Game For Children’s Hospital Fund:

Staples Center in downtown Los Angeles is home to the Lakers

The Los Angeles Clippers will raise funds for Children’s Hospital of Los Angeles’ Helping Hands Fund at tonight’s game against the Utah Jazz at Staples Center, which has been designated as Dedicated Awareness Night.

Donation canisters will be located around Star Plaza outside Staples Center, the arena’s Team L.A. Store and L.A. Live across Chick Hearn Court from the arena.

Donations can also be made by texting CHLA to 41444 or by calling (844) LAC-GIVE (522-4489) from 5:30-11 p.m. Donations will be matched up to $25,000 by the Clippers organization with support from Fox Sports.

The fund supports critical, lifesaving care for every child treated, regardless of a family’s ability to pay.
